Apple's First Foldable iPhone: Mass Production in 2026, Price Tag Over $2,000, AI Experience as Core Selling Point
A recent report by renowned industry analyst Ming-Chi Kuo offers detailed insights into Apple's first foldable iPhone, covering hardware specifications, development progress, and market positioning. The report states that the large-size foldable iPhone's starting price is expected to exceed $2,000 to $2,500 (approximately 14,000 RMB), positioning it as a true AI phone aimed at delivering multimodal and cross-app AI experiences.
Kuo's analysis suggests that current smartphone manufacturers need to continuously increase screen sizes to enhance user experience with AI features, a key reason behind Apple's foray into the foldable market. The report indicates that Apple's first foldable phone will feature an inward-folding (large fold) design, with an approximately 5.5-inch outer screen and a 7.8-inch inner screen when unfolded, promising a crease-free display.
Regarding the camera system, Apple appears to have made some compromises. This foldable iPhone will feature a dual rear camera system, unlike the triple-camera setup found in its Pro series. Notably, it will include a front-facing camera on both the inner and outer screens. Due to the pursuit of extreme thinness, Apple has abandoned Face ID, but the report suggests that Touch ID fingerprint recognition may return, integrated into a side button.
The report also details the phone's dimensions and materials. Folded, it's expected to be approximately 9 to 9.5 mm thick, and unfolded, 4.5 to 4.8 mm. The hinge will use composite materials, while the frame will be made of durable titanium alloy. Furthermore, it will reportedly feature a next-generation high-density battery for improved battery life.
Kuo predicts that production of Apple's first foldable iPhone will begin in the third quarter of this year, with small-scale mass production anticipated in the fourth quarter of 2026, with initial shipments estimated at 3 to 5 million units. Shipment volumes are not likely to reach 20 million units until the second-generation product launches in 2027.
The delayed mass production until next year is attributed to two key factors: Apple's extremely high standards for hardware quality, particularly regarding the crease-free inner screen displaya technological hurdle currently being tackled by Android manufacturersand, according to AppleIntelligence's forecast, the expectation that foldable screen technology will not reach widespread adoption and mass-market viability until next year.
This highlights the AI-driven focus of Apple's foldable phone development. Apple aims to achieve optimal hardware-software balance, upholding its consistent commitment to prioritizing user experience.
The specifications and design details of this foldable iPhone underscore Apple's unwavering pursuit of product quality and user experience. From the large inner and outer screens to the crease-free display technology and the emphasis on thinness and durability, it showcases Apple's capabilities and ambition in the foldable phone arena. Positioning the AI experience as the core selling point further demonstrates Apple's accurate grasp of future mobile device trends.
The high price tag signals that this foldable iPhone is not targeted at the mass market but rather at high-end consumers. Apple sees this product as a crucial component of its competitiveness in the premium mobile device market, hoping to win over discerning customers with superior performance and user experience.
The 2026 mass production timeline also reflects Apple's cautious approach to foldable screen technology. Despite its strong supply chain management capabilities, Apple remains highly cautious in its first foray into foldable devices, prioritizing product quality and technological maturity. The strategy of small-scale initial production provides valuable time and experience for subsequent product iterations and improvements.
